Proto-Sino-Tibetan: *po
Meaning: kinship term
Tibetan: (Ben.) phu-bo elder brother.
Burmese: ǝphǝwh grandfather, bǝwh father; LB *p[h]ǝwx.
Kachin: kǝphu2 elder brother.
Lushai: pu a grandfather.
Kiranti: *bä́ (~ *bǝ́, *bá)
Comments: Mikir phu; BG: Garo bu, Bodo bǝ́w grandfather; Kham bobo husband's father. Ben. 19. Cf. PAN *pueq, *e(m)pu 'lord, master'.
